Надсилай резюме
Підпишись на вакансії
Запитай в рекрутера

Middle Scala Developer

Проект: HERE
ЛьвівКиївОдесаХарків Scala Intermediate 11692

Наш клієнт – глобальний лідер на ринку електронних карт та геолокаційних сервісів. Продукти компанії користуються значним попитом та доступні у майже 200 країнах світу. Виступаючи стратегічним R&D партнером компанії в Україні, Intellias допомагає клієнту розробляти технологічне ядро або, іншими словами, платформу, що є основою будь-якого продукту чи рішення компанії. Дізнатись більше про проект

Надіслати резюме

Project Overview:

In cooperation with the leading global provider of maps, traffic and places data enabling navigation, location-based services and mobile advertising around the world, Intellias is looking for skilled Scala developer with excellent communication skills and strong technical background.
Intellias team is responsible for full-cycle development of the navigation solution, including specs/RQ analysis, architecture creation, development, E2E testing and integration into the target system.
The API was requested in the scope of HERE Auto SDK map update and service entitlement project. It is needed to fulfill requirements to enable installing a signed map on a device.

Technologies: 

  • Scala;
  • Play REST;
  • TDD/BDD (ScalaTest, Mockito), PerfTest (Jmeter);
  • AWS (CLI, S3, DynamoDB);
  • Cryptography for REST basics (JWT, OAuth2, HTTPS, Certificates, KeyStore);
  • CI (Jenkins), Gerrit/Git, GoCD;
  • Networking. 

Responsibilities

  • Participate in technical discussions to find a right architecture/design solution;
  • Develop new features;
  • Provide design, implementation and complete testing of new features in supported programming languages (Scala);
  • Design interfaces and implementation to support reusability, testability, and modularity.

Requirements :

  • 3+ years of experience in software engineering;
  • Excellent analytical, algorithmic and optimization skills;
  • Proficient in Scala;
  • Basic level of knowledge of Java;
  • Advance knowledge and experience with SQL (MySQL / PostgreSQL);
  • OOAD, architecture and design patterns;
  • Understanding of typical distributed architectures (WS, messaging, clusters, big data, caching, etc.), scalability;
  • Experience with design and development of high throughput distributed data processing systems;
  • Understanding of Agile methodologies and engineering practices;
  • Upper-intermediate level of English, well-developed communication skills.
Надіслати резюме
Квітослава Пасічник

Рекрутер

Зінаїда Козачук

Рекрутер

Андрій Легкий

Рекрутер

Ольга Цимбалюк

Рекрутер